Baia

The lowdown: Opening tomorrow at the Esplanade Mall, Baia is a sophisticated rooftop dining and lounge bar by Beppe De Vito of the ilLido Group. Spanning the entire 465-sqm rooftop, this is a chic lifestyle destination replete with live DJs, comfortable outdoor seating and panoramic views of the city. We expect plenty of tourists, Instagram boyfriends and people-watching.

What to order: Drinks are curated by Proof & Co, a beverage consultancy renowned for shaping cocktail culture across Asia, while the food menu features a selection of small plates and big flavours. Dig into dishes like Seared Bluefin Tuna with Oscietra Caviar and Truffle Fonduta Pizza, as you sip on refreshing aperitivos like the Singapolitan, made with Brass Lion Singapore Dry Gin, plum wine, salted strawberry and prosecco.

Writers Bar

The low-down: Founded as tribute to the many literary greats who have stayed at Raffles Hotel Singapore, Writers Bar is a sophisticated space with a curated trove of inventive cocktails. The drinks experience changes accordingly to the work of the writer-in-residence, who is currently Madeleine Lee, the first Singaporean writer (and poet) to be appointed one under the Raffles’ Writer’s Residency Programme.

What to order: The menu ranges from cocktails inspired by How to Build a Lux Hotel, a new book of poems by Lee, to a variety of highballs and the Million Dollar Cocktail, a pineapple-based gin sour invented by Ngiam Tong Boon, the Raffles bartender who also invented the Singapore Sling. There’s also a special two-day collaboration happening this weekend with The Curator, an award-winning bar from the Philippines. Co-founder David Ong and head bartender Sciemon Sober will be around to showcase four signature cocktails, including the Pandesal, a Filipino bread roll-inspired drink made with Bruichladdich, pandesal, espresso, cream, bitters, nutmeg and salt.
